Output d63d7ec29b0618d60fc5b6294dca54dadf49cff77c4fd6ffe9a3bc72dc08cd92:4

value
51004
script pubkey
OP_0 OP_PUSHBYTES_20 75195e5dc263cb494e9b11ca0a2f0a839d7fef8f
address
bc1qw5v4uhwzv095jn5mz89q5tc2swwhlmu0zclxw8
transaction
d63d7ec29b0618d60fc5b6294dca54dadf49cff77c4fd6ffe9a3bc72dc08cd92
confirmations
1335
spent
true